Manuel Perea is an academic researcher from University of Valencia. The author has contributed to research in topics: Lexical decision task & Priming (psychology). The author has an hindex of 51, co-authored 262 publications receiving 9254 citations. Previous affiliations of Manuel Perea include Universidad Católica de Valencia San Vicente Mártir & Massachusetts Institute of Technology.

Contextual diversity favors the learning of new words in children regardless of their comprehension skills.

TL;DR: This article examined the effect of high contextual diversity in young readers aged 11-13 years and found that words encountered in different contexts were learned more effectively than those presented in the same context.
